-===== Setting LD_LIBRARY_PATH =====+==== Setting LD_LIBRARY_PATH ====
  
 Loading a module does no longer automatically set the ''LD_LIBRARY_PATH'' environment variable, as with some software packages this has lead to conflicts with system libraries.
